Everolimus + calcineurin inhibitor is a combination immunosuppressive therapy used primarily in kidney and other solid organ transplantation. Everolimus is a mammalian target of rapamycin (mTOR) inhibitor that suppresses T-cell and B-cell proliferation by inhibiting the mTOR pathway, which is critical for cell cycle progression in lymphocytes. Calcineurin inhibitors (CNIs), such as cyclosporine and tacrolimus, inhibit calcineurin phosphatase activity, thereby blocking T-cell activation and interleukin-2 production. The combination takes advantage of their complementary mechanisms: everolimus allows for a reduction in CNI dosing, which can minimize nephrotoxicity while maintaining effective immunosuppression. This strategy has shown efficacy in reducing the incidence of acute rejection, preserving renal function, and lowering the risk of infection and certain malignancies compared to full-dose CNI regimens[1][2][3][4].
